Bringing the stuffing box into operation
after re-packing
Tighten the stuffing box only slightly before
bringing it into operation. When the pump
starts, a leak rate of 50 to 200 drops per
minute is permitted.
During the running-in process of approximately
30 minutes, tighten the stuffing box gland (203)
incrementally via the hexagon nuts (202) to set
a minimum leak of 2 to 20 drops per minute.
Caution!
The temperature of the stuffing box
may not increase abnormally during
this time. Approximately 20 to 60 °C
above the temperature of the
pumped liquid is permissible. If
temperature increases suddenly,
immediately loosen the stuffing box
gland and repeat the run-in
process. The leak can be directed
through the threaded hole located
in the bearing bracket’s drip pan.
Eliminate any possibility of injury
and environmental damage caused
by leaks of hazardous materials!
9.1.4.2
Mechanical seal
Unbalanced mechanical seals are used in all
material pairings and versions. The mechanical
seal is maintenance free.
In the event of strong wear-induced leaks, the
mechanical seal must be replaced (
section
10.1 page 26).
Caution!
Since dry-running of a mechanical
seal must be avoided, the pump
may be switched on only when
filled and with any additional
equipment switched on (
section
7.1.2 page 18)!
